The IRS has again extended the filing deadline. A police box will be installed on the Phinikoudes embankment in Larnaca. Parliament is discussing a bill on cash transactions over €10,000.

The IRS has again extended the deadline for filing 2023 returns. The deadline is now set for November 30th. This is the second extension this year. The decision was made at a meeting of the Cabinet of Ministers. A police box and information kiosk will be installed on the Phinikoudes embankment in Larnaca, as well as patrolling will be stepped up. The decision was made at a meeting between Larnaca Mayor Andreas Viras and Police Chief Themistos Arnaoutis. It was a response to increasing incidents of violence on the popular promenade. Parliament is debating a bill that would abolish all existing exemptions and make it completely illegal to purchase goods or services with cash in excess of €10,000, even if the payment is split into several instalments. The legislative proposal provides for a fine of 10% of the amount for businesses that violate this requirement. Read also:
